Oven temperatures: Fan-forced vs. Conventional

All our oven reheating instructions are for fan‑forced ovens that’s the setting most Aussie households use.

  • Using a conventional (top‑and‑bottom) oven? Simply add 10 °C or allow an extra 5–10 minutes to reach the same result.

  • Unsure which oven you have? If your oven symbol shows a little fan, it’s fan‑forced. No fan means conventional.
    Whichever mode you choose, always heat until the food is piping hot (above 75 °C) before serving.

How do I prepare the meals at home?

How do I prepare them?
Each product label describes the best method for the dish—choose oven, air‑fryer or saucepan for best results.

  • Oven / Air‑fryer (bakes, pies, lasagnes, quiches, pastries) – 30‑35 min at 180‑200 °C until piping hot and golden if reheated from thawed.

  • Saucepan (curries, stews, soups, sauces) – defrost pack, then warm gently 8‑10 min over medium heat, stirring occasionally.

  • Microwave only for single‑serve meals when you’re truly short on time; 6‑8 min on medium‑high from frozen or 2-3min from thawed. We don’t recommend it for most dishes because rapid heating can dry the food and dull its flavour. 

How long will the meals last in the fridge?

We deliver everything frozen for maximum freshness, so keep meals in the freezer until the day before you want them. Once thawed in the fridge (below 5 °C), you can keep them up to 2 / 3 days maximum. 

Never refreeze a meal that's been thawed and always check the Expiry Date on the label for dish-specific guidance.
